WebUsing ultraviolet photography, a researcher in Austria has discovered a fragment of the Christian gospels written in Old Syriac. The original text was written in the 6th century, but then later erased and copied over hundreds of years later. Grigory Kessel, a researcher from the Austrian Academy of Sciences made the discovery and has reported ...

WebA growing interest in, and revival of, medieval architecture from the late 18th century prompted further study, and the work of historical novelists, notably Sir Walter Scott, widened interest in them considerably. By the later 19th century a more scientific approach to their historic fabric was being . developed by historians such as George Clark.
